<p>It depends. There is a brand of conservatism which allows the government to step in when the capitalist system fails. In Canada, it allowed the Canadian government to buy out the bankrupt competitors of Canadian Pacific, consolidating the assets into the crown corporation Canadian National. By maintaining competition as a crown corporation, Canadian Pacific was prevented from obtaining a monopoly in the Canadian railway industry, or in grain haulage. The railroad functioned for decades and was eventually sold off, becoming one of the continent&#8217;s giants.</p>
<p>In America, the collapse of passenger railroads led to the creation of Amtrak, and the collapse of Pennsylvania Railroad, New York Central, New Haven and an assortment of shortlines led to the creation of the government-run Conrail, which lasted for two decades before being bought out by Norfolk Southern.
